Job summary To provide a specialist Advanced Paramedic resource for health care professionals and service users, working in collaboration with other members of the Multidisciplinary Team To work within the community as an autonomous, accountable, Advanced Paramedic Practitioner, in the provision of a holistic approach for individuals including assessment, diagnosis and treatment, to deliver quality patient services To assess, diagnose, treat, refer or signpost patients/service users who attend surgery with undifferentiated or undiagnosed conditions relating to minor illness or minor injury The post holder will use advanced clinical skills to provide education to service users, promoting self-care and empower them to make informed choices about their treatment The post holder must own a vehicle for home visits, for which expenses will be remunerated. Job responsibilities Diagnosing and treating patients presenting with minor illness: Triage and treat patients wishing to see a health care professional, including referral to other healthcare services according to practice protocols Ensure clinical practice is safe and effective and remains within boundaries of competence, and to acknowledge limitations. Advise patients on general health care and minor ailments, with referral to other members of the primary and secondary health care team as necessary and in line with relevant protocols Works from the surgery and within communities as an autonomous practitioner caring for patients and families. Works as an autonomous practitioner, in accordance with the Health Care Professions Council (HCPC).

Ensure that personal and professional clinical standards are maintained. To undertake assessment for patients within the community and those attending the surgery, using diagnostic skills and initiation of investigations where appropriate If a prescriber, to prescribe medications as appropriate following policy, patient group directives and local pathways. If not a prescriber, to liaise with a GP/prescriber as appropriate To formally and informally impart knowledge and skills to colleagues promoting peer review and best practice within the work environment To communicate at all levels within the team ensuring an effective service is delivered. To maintain accurate, contemporaneous healthcare records appropriate to the consultation.

Ensure evidence-based care is delivered at the highest standards ensuring delivery of high-quality patient care Work with local policies and procedures Enhance own performance through Continuous Professional Development, imparting own knowledge and behaviours to meet the needs of the service To achieve and demonstrate agreed standards of personal and professional development in order to meet the needs of the service To participate in the audit process, evaluation and implementation plans and practice change in order to meet patient need Contribute positively to the effectiveness and efficiency of the team and work colleagues Work in partnership with other APP/GP for local residential nursing home.Pathological specimens and investigatory procedures: Undertake the collection of pathological specimens including intravenous blood samples, swabs etc. Perform investigatory procedures requested by the GPs within competences.Administration and professional responsibilities: Participate in the administrative and professional responsibilities of the practice team Ensure accurate and legible notes of all consultations and treatments are recorded in the patients notes Ensure the clinical computer system is kept up to date, with accurate details recorded and updated Ensure appropriate items of service claims are made accurately, reporting any problems to the practice manager Ensure accurate completion of all necessary documentation associated with patient health care and registration with the practice Ensure collection and maintenance of statistical information required for regular and ad hoc reports and audit Attend and participate in practice meetings as required Restocking and maintenance of practice emergency equipment, and your own clinical areas.Training and personal development Training requirements will be monitored by yearly appraisal and will be in accordance with practice requirements. Personal development will be encouraged and supported by the practice. It is the individuals responsibility to remain up to date with recent developments Participate in the education and training of students of all disciplines and the introduction of all members of the practice staff where appropriate Maintain continued education by attendance at courses and study days as deemed useful or necessary for professional development, ensuring PREP requirements are met If it is necessary to expand the role to include additional responsibilities, full training will be given Develop and maintain a Personal Learning Plan Keep up to date with statutory / mandatory training in line with Didcot Health Centre and NHS guidelines.
